I’m in Buenos Aires right now getting ready to head to Patagonia for a week. Buenos Aires is one of my favorite cities; tango dancers in the cobblestone streets, colorful buildings and architecture, fantastic wine and steak (food is important for the travel photographer!). Since this is such a vibrant city, I like to capture what I love about this city, the passion of the people.

Capturing emotion is a great self assignment. You can have technically correct images, but these shots don’t evoke a strong response in the viewer. I may follow the rule of thirds, get my exposure and focus just perfect, but if the image has no emotion or mood then it won’t be a great shot. Seek out strong colors, interesting light and physical displays of emotion, all of which will produce an emotional response in the viewer.

Capturing passion in Buenos Aires isn’t to difficult. Many of the popular plazas have tango dancers on the corner. This dance is all about passion, and the best dancers ooze out fiery passionate expressions. The couple in this image worked with us to dance in a cobble street right at twilight. This scene can’t get much hotter!
